| Shelburne NS Shipyard May Have New Owners Soon |
|
Irving Shipbuilding is apparently interested in the purchase of the Shelburne Ship Repair Yard in Nova Scotia. Irving has been leasing the facility for more than 10 years and plans to employ 60 people when/if a purchase deal goes through. The company also plans to do major repairs to the facility. The shipyard is currently owned by the Nova Scotia government and Irving has an option to buy it for a dollar. Irving laid off 60 workers when it closed the yard last year, but has since rehired 25 people to work on the upgrades and another 20 for a refit in Halifax. Irving has been negotiating with the province for a few months and town officials expects that process to wrap up in another month or so.
